Maxxess appoints Russell Baker as UK and Ireland Business Development

Maxxess has appointed Russell Baker as Business Development & Account Manager, who will be based out of the company’s European head office in Bracknell, UK, and will handle the increase in demand for the firm’s eFusion access control and security management platform. Maxxess Systems partners with Digital Watchdog

Maxxess Systems and Digital Watchdog have formed a partnership to deliver a complete video surveillance solution for managing security threats.
